Janice was a graduate of Southeast High School, class of 1955. She had retired from the Oklahoma City Police Department after 23 years. Janice enjoyed bowling and golfing, but most of all she loved spending time with her family and friends.
She is survived by 3 sons, Don and wife Shelly, Kevin and wife Sissy, Kendall and wife Cari 7 grandchildren, Kristena, Keri, Kristen, Laci, Steven, Shane and Lance 4 great-grandchildren, Xavier, Kelbie, Noah and Mykensi 2 sisters, Norma Tippit and Carole Hume 1 brother, Donald Waller and numerous family and friends. Janice is preceded in death by husband, Don K. Bowen 1 son, Kyle Bowen.
Services held Monday, December 8, 2008 at John M. Ireland Funeral Home and Chapel, Moore, OK. Interment to follow at Resthaven Memory Gardens, OKC. Services are under the direction of John M. Ireland Funeral Home and Chapel, Moore, OK.
